Comprehending Double Pane Windows

Double pane windows, also understood as insulated glass systems (IGUs), include two glass panes separated by a space filled with air or gas. This design supplies a thermal barrier, reducing heat transfer in between the inside and outside of the home, leading to lower energy expenses. In spite of their sturdiness, double pane windows can struggle with a number of issues, consisting of seal failure, condensation, and frame problems.

double-glazing-repairs.png

Typical Issues with Double Pane Windows

  1. Seal Failure: The seals that keep the panes airtight can weaken over time, causing moisture build-up in between the panes.

  2. Condensation: When the seal fails, humidity can get in the area in between the panes, resulting in condensation that obstructs exposure and lowers the window's effectiveness.

  3. Frame Damage: The window frame may suffer from rot, warping, or breaking due to moisture exposure or temperature level fluctuations.

  4. Drafts: External air leakages can happen if the Window Maintenance is poorly set up or if the insulation has actually stopped working.

Signs You Need Double Pane Window Repair

Recognizing the signs of potential damage early can assist prevent expensive repairs later on. House owners should keep an eye on for:

  • Foggy or Indistinct Glass: This often suggests seal failure and moisture buildup.
  • Noticeable Moisture Between Panes: Condensation or pooling water between the glass panes is a clear sign that the seal has actually broken.
  • Cracks in Glass or Frame: Any noticeable damage can impact the stability of the window.
  • Increased Energy Bills: If heating or cooling costs have risen unexpectedly, it might indicate ineffectiveness in your windows.
  • Squeaky or Stuck Windows: Difficulty in opening or closing windows may suggest frame warping or other underlying issues.

Repairing Double Pane Windows

Fixing double pane windows typically depends upon the nature of the damage. Here are typical methods for dealing with problems:

1. Replacing Sealant

If the seal has failed however glass panes are intact, the repair may include eliminating the old sealant and applying a brand-new one. This is normally done through:

  • Professional Service: Hiring a qualified Window Frame Repair technician is recommended for re-sealing because it requires specialized tools.
  • DIY Method: Homeowners can attempt this by thoroughly eliminating the old seals and using silicone-based sealants, though this method is less reliable.

2. Glass Replacement

If the glass itself is harmed, replacing one or both panes might be required. This can involve:

  • Removing the Window Frame: Carefully disassemble the window to access the glass.
  • Glass Units Purchasing: Order a new glass unit that fits your existing frame.
  • Installation: Install the new Experienced Glass Repair and guarantee all seals are airtight.

3. Complete Window Replacement

In cases of substantial frame damage or if the expense of repairs approaches the rate of brand-new windows, complete window replacement may be the most feasible option. This involves:

  • Measuring: Accurate measurements are vital for fitting the brand-new window.
  • Frame and Trim Removal: Dismantle the existing frame.
  • Installing New Windows: Follow proper installation methods to make sure energy performance.

4. Short-lived Fixes

For minor problems, there are short-lived services up until an appropriate repair can be done:

  • Use of Plastic Window Film: This can decrease drafts during colder months.
  • Weatherstripping: Installing weatherstripping can assist seal gaps until full repairs are finished.

Maintenance Tips for Double Pane Windows

Preventative maintenance can extend the life of double pane windows and help prevent repairs. Here are some suggestions:

  • Regular Cleaning: Clean the window panes and frames periodically to get rid of particles and inspect for indications of wear.
  • Check Seals: Check the seals routinely for damage and ensure no wetness is trapped in between the panes.
  • Maintain Frame Condition: Repair any fractures or chips in the frame quickly to avoid moisture from going into.
  • Professional Inspections: Schedule periodic checks by a window professional to catch issues early.

FAQs about Double Pane Window Repair

Q1: Can I repair double pane windows myself?A1: While some minor repairs can be done by homeowners, significant issues, specifically those needing glass replacement, are best dealt with by professionals. Q2: How can I tell if the window needs changing rather of repairing?A2: If the repair costs approach or exceed 50 %of the price of
a new window, it might be time to replace. Q3: How long do double pane windows typically last?A3: With

correct maintenance, double pane windows can last 20 years or more, although seal failures can take place quicker. Q4: What are the advantages of fixing instead of replacing the window?A4: Repairing is frequently more cost-efficient and can extend the life expectancy of the existing window if done properly.
